Job Summary

We are seeking a highly skilled Property Manager to join our team at Brookfield Properties. As a Property Manager, you will be responsible for overseeing the daily operations of an apartment community, including general administration, leasing and occupancy, maintenance of the property, and management of all property associates.

Key Responsibilities
  • Supervise and coordinate the daily operations of an apartment community, including general administration, leasing and occupancy, maintenance of the property, and management of all property associates.
  • Maintain the physical assets and performance of the property to achieve the highest possible net operating income, without compromising the quality of the property's appearance or level of service.
  • Monitor regulatory compliance and company policies and procedures related to property management and ensure that all associates are familiar with and understand them.
  • Establish and coordinate a communication system involving transactions and activities between property associates and the Corporate Office.
  • Complete performance evaluations on supervised associates and ensure the highest level of performance and professionalism of supervised associates.
  • Respond to emergency situations, contacting appropriate Regional Managers or agencies as necessary.
  • Perform functions of Assistant Property Manager, as needed.
  • Prepare purchase orders and approve expenditures within specified budgetary guidelines.
  • Review, understand, analyze, and make recommendations for vendor contracts to Regional Manager.
  • Assist with the preparation of the annual operating budget for the property as well as projections.
  • Review monthly operating results with Regional Manager and assist with the preparation of written variance reports.
  • Maintain a working knowledge of all maintenance programs and capital improvement projects to ensure the proper and efficient operation of systems, preventive maintenance programs, housekeeping functions, and responses to resident service requests.
  • Ensure compliance with housing quality standards.
  • Coordinate with Engineering Department on all major maintenance issues.
  • Assist with the development and implementation of a marketing plan for the property based on a careful and factual analysis of competitive properties.
  • Coordinate the advertising and promotional needs of the property to maximize marketing plans and on all major marketing issues with the Marketing Department.
  • Ensure that the property complies with affirmative marketing procedures and goals.
  • Meet with prospective residents, identify their housing needs, interview them to determine eligibility based on established criteria, show vacant and model suites (where applicable), and property amenities based on established techniques specified by the company.
  • Quote established rental rates and promotions (where applicable).
  • Make follow-up calls, send follow-up literature, and pursue rental status.
  • Collect funds related to applications, security deposits, and rentals.
  • Approve all applicants for residency, including eligibility for affordable housing programs (if applicable), approve all leasing documents, and ensure that all application fees, deposits, and move-in monies are collected.
  • Collect rent from residents, verify amounts paid, account for discrepancies, deposit rent daily, send verifying information to Corporate Office, and follow up on any delinquent rents, initiating collection and/or eviction procedures as necessary.
  • Conduct move-in and/or move-out inspections of apartments, charge residents for applicable damages or unpaid fees, prepare and approve related move-out documents, send verifying documentation to Corporate Office, and maintain on-site records.
  • Conduct move-in inspections to determine market readiness and implement housing quality standards.
  • Perform interim unit inspections annually or as directed.
Qualifications
  • High School Diploma/GED.
  • 3-4 years of required experience in a Supervisory role and Property Management.
  • Preferred certifications for this position include: Accredited Residential Manager (ARM), Certified Property Manager (CPM), Certified Property Manager (CAM), or Certified Property Manager (IREM).
  • Required skills for this position include: fair housing laws, Microsoft Office, and leadership/supervisory skills.
  • Preferred skills for this position include: affordable housing programs at select properties, One-Site, landlord/tenant knowledge, and LRO.
